How to Charge Your Homeika Vacuum
To charge your Homeika vacuum correctly, follow these simple steps:
Step 1: Locate the Charging Dock
Find a suitable, dry, and flat surface to place your charging dock. This location should be close to an electrical outlet for easy access.
Step 2: Plug in the Power Adapter
Carefully connect the power adapter to the charging dock. Ensure the connection is secure to avoid any interruptions during charging.
Step 3: Position Your Vacuum
Align your Homeika vacuum correctly with the charging contacts on the dock. The vacuum should fit snugly to create an effective connection.
Step 4: Observe Charging Indicators
Once positioned, watch for the LED indicator lights on your vacuum. Usually, a flashing light indicates that charging has begun, while a static light means it’s fully charged.
Step 5: Charging Duration
Most Homeika vacuums take around 4 to 5 hours to charge fully. However, consult your user manual for specific details, as charging times may vary depending on the model and battery condition.
Best Practices for Charging Your Homeika Vacuum
To maximize the performance and lifespan of your Homeika vacuum, follow these best practices:
Use the Right Charging Equipment
Always use the original charging dock and power adapter provided. Third-party equipment may not deliver the appropriate voltage, risking damage to your vacuum.
Avoid Overcharging
Though many modern devices have overcharge protection, consistently overcharging can still impact battery health in the long run. It’s advisable to unplug the charger once it shows a full charge.
Charge Regularly
For optimal performance, make charging a routine. Avoid letting your vacuum’s battery drain completely before recharging. A good practice is to charge it after every cleaning session or at least every few days.
Store the Vacuum Properly
When not in use, store the vacuum in a cool, dry place, ideally at room temperature. Extreme temperatures can negatively affect the battery performance.
Troubleshooting Common Charging Issues
If you notice any issues while charging your Homeika vacuum, consider the following solutions:
Check Connections
Make sure all connections are secure. This includes the connection between the vacuum and the charging dock, as well as the dock to the power outlet.
Inspect the Power Adapter
Look for any visible signs of damage on the power adapter. If you notice fraying or exposed wires, stop using it immediately and replace it.
Battery Maintenance
If your battery seems not to hold a charge, it may be time to assess its condition. Lithium-ion batteries typically last between 2 to 3 years, but this can vary based on usage and charging habits.

How can I extend the battery life of my Homeika vacuum?
To extend the battery life of your Homeika vacuum, it’s essential to practice smart charging habits. Avoid overcharging by unplugging the vacuum once it reaches a full charge. Regularly clean the vacuum to minimize strain on the battery during use, as clogged filters can force the machine to work harder, draining the battery faster.
Additionally, try to store your vacuum in a cool, dry place and avoid exposing it to extreme temperatures, which can damage the battery. If you anticipate not using your vacuum for an extended period, consider running it down to about 50% charge before storage, as keeping it fully charged can shorten its lifespan.
